Description from the seller

Architectural column/capital in Carrara white Statuario marble and Siena yellow marble.
Italian artwork entirely hand-sculpted with hammer and chisel.

• ERA: (19th century)
• DIMENSIONS: 92 cm Height • 25.5 cm • 25.5 cm (Top Base)
30 cm • 30 cm (Bottom Base)
50 kg

• Disassemblable into 3 parts (Excellent for shipping and handling).

• CONDITION: EXCELLENT! Minimal signs.
